KDE desktop

KDE has been around since the early days of Linux and is Bo Weaver's favorite. With age comes stability and KDE is a very stable desktop. The look and feel are very similar to Windows, so for a Windows user it is easy to use. One advantage of KDE is that the desktop is highly configurable. If you don't like what it looks like, just change it. This can be a big advantage. KDE comes with all the latest Jumping Monkeys and features. You probably like your desktop environment your way, like we do. It doesn't matter what latest thing has been added as long as you can configure the desktop to be the same as it has been for years.
